Description
Halbert Magna is a 19-year-old human male standing over 190 centimeters tall, possessing a solid build, broad shoulders, and distinctive red hair. He is the son of Glaive Magna and a childhood friend of Kaede Foxia. Initially serving in Duke Georg Carmine's army, Halbert held strong anti-royalist views and publicly criticized King Kazuya Souma's policies, like the dismissal of corrupt nobles. An argument with Kaede at a cafe, where he declared intent to join Carmine's rebellion while the disguised king and retinue listened, nearly resulted in treason charges. Instead of execution, he was reassigned to the Forbidden Army under Kaede Foxia's command as discipline.
Resentful of his road construction labor initially, Halbert was placated by Souma's experimental cuisine. He rescued the dark elf Velza during a landslide operation in the God-Protected Forest. His combat prowess emerged in the One Week War, defending Randel fortress against Zemish mercenaries and rebellious nobles; he attacked enemies at range using fire-wreathed throwing spears, aiding the successful defense until Souma's reinforcements arrived. Later, during the siege of Van in Amidonia, he led a platoon on the Elfrieden army's left wing. In a decisive clash, he bisected an enemy general's torso and beheaded the general's horse, causing Amidonian soldiers to flee and earning him the moniker "Hal the Red Ogre".
Halbert evolved from hot-headedness to disciplined maturity. After the war, he proposed to Kaede Foxia, formalizing their relationship. On a mission to the Star Dragon Mountain Range, he accidentally forged a magical contract with the dragon Ruby, resulting in a polygamous marriage to both Kaede and Ruby.
He specializes in fire-element magic, channeling it through weapons to create explosive effects or engulf his spears in flames. His primary armaments are the enchanted Twin Snake Spears from the Republic of Turgis, connected by a chain. These withstand his fire magic without disintegrating and can be retrieved via their chains, though mastering their complexity demands significant skill.
Halbert maintains a unique rapport with King Souma, permitted to bypass formal etiquette. This positions him as Souma's counterpart: Halbert embodies impulsive, martial leadership, contrasting the king's strategic, administrative approach. Their differences extend to their dragon companions; Halbert partners with the conventional red dragon Ruby, while Souma contracts the wingless Naden.
